Abstract

Provided is an article for cleaning, superior in collecting efficiency of dust and dirt, and efficiently performing cleaning over a wide range of a wiping surface, and easy in manufacture. A first cleaning element 10 and a second cleaning element 20 are joined by a first joining part 7, and the respective cleaning elements are deformed, and are formed into a structure of superposing a sub-cleaning element 6 on the wiping surface 3 side of a main cleaning element 5. The inside edges 10B and 20B of the sub-cleaning element 6 are positioned inside the outside edges 10A and 20A of the main cleaning element 5. The respective cleaning elements are formed of an aggregate of fiber opened from a tow and a paper strip-shape piece. On a wiping surface 3, both the outside edges 10A and 20A and the inside edges 10B and 20B can exhibit the collecting effect of the dirt.
